Ok, so I think I will start updating this blog more now, I've been slacking. So far in my opinion the fastest way to get into shape and see results fast is to mix it up. I am on routine of about 5 days a week hitting the gym. To keep things interesting and see results I have been changing up my weekly routine for the workouts. For example, I will spend a week of doing circuits, the next week do something heavy. As cliche as it sounds, Men's Fitness has some good workouts that if you follow you can really keep your routine fresh.
